Qigong and Meditation
The first kind of Chinese Medicine methods that you should become aware of are those that can be administered by the individual. Among other methods, meditation is one that is often used and it is also effective in providing suitable healing. Qigong is an ancient way in which energy is moved and another method worth learning. Tailoring the diet and exercise are other methods used in Chinese Medicine.
Acupuncture, Herbal Medicine and Moxibustion as a Method of Chinese Medicine
Other Chinese Medicine methods can be helped to align the body, in case the above methods don’t work. One of the best examples of this is Acupuncture. Other methods include herbal medicines and moxibustion which is the burning of different herbs.
